What Is Gum Line Reshaping?
Gum line reshaping is a cosmetic and sometimes therapeutic dental treatment that removes or restructures excess gum tissue to reveal more tooth surface and create a healthier, symmetrical gum appearance. Procedures can range from minor laser reshaping around a few teeth to full arch contouring, depending on the patient’s smile goals and gum condition.
Laser technology is commonly used in Korean dental clinics to perform minimally invasive reshaping with faster healing and reduced discomfort.
Typical Gum Line Reshaping Fees in Korea
In Korea, gum line reshaping costs vary based on the method used and the extent of tissue contouring needed:
Minor reshaping (small area or per tooth):
₩70,000 – ₩300,000 typical range for cosmetic contouring of limited teeth or areas.
Full arch gum contouring:
₩800,000 – ₩1,500,000 for broader reshaping across a larger portion of the smile.
Comprehensive or advanced reshaping:
₩1,200,000 – ₩2,000,000+ for extensive aesthetic cases or combined treatments.
Some clinics also run promotional pricing or seasonal discounts, so confirmed costs can vary between practices.
Why Prices Vary by Clinic and Treatment
The final cost of gum line reshaping in Korea depends on several key factors:
1. Procedure complexity
Minor reshaping around a few teeth costs less than full arch or multi-tooth contouring.
2. Technology used
Laser gum contouring tends to be priced higher than basic manual reshaping because it offers greater precision and faster recovery.
3. Clinic reputation and location
Clinics in central Seoul neighborhoods often have higher fees reflecting premium service offerings.
4. Additional services
Consultation, local anesthesia, post-op care, and combination cosmetic treatments (like veneers or whitening) may be included or charged separately.
What’s Typically Included in the Fee
Most gum line reshaping fees at Korean dental clinics include:
- Professional dental exam and smile assessment
- Local anesthesia and pain management
- Reshaping of targeted gum tissue
- Post-treatment instructions and follow-up care
Some clinics also offer digital smile design consultations to visualize outcomes before treatment.
Laser Gum Contouring vs Traditional Methods
Laser gum contouring is one of the most sought-after reshaping options because it:
- Minimizes bleeding and swelling
- Reduces recovery time
- Improves precision and symmetry
Traditional surgical reshaping may still be recommended for complex cases or when combined with other periodontal procedures.
Both options should be evaluated during a dental consultation to determine the most effective and cost-efficient approach.
Is Gum Line Reshaping Covered by Insurance?
Gum line reshaping for purely cosmetic reasons — such as improving smile aesthetics — is typically not covered by Korean national health insurance and is treated as a non-insured cosmetic dental service. Always confirm coverage and separate costs with your clinic during consultation.
